Overview

Arturo uses deep learning to extract detailed physical property characteristics and predictive analysis from satellite, aerial, stratospheric and ground-level imagery, often delivering results in as little as five seconds. The company increased the number of extractable property attributes to 71 within the past 18 months and has completed over 35 million on-demand property analyses since becoming commercially available in 2018. Arturo spun out from American Family Insurance and serves property & casualty insurers, reinsurers, lenders and the securities markets. It reports revenue growth of over 300% in the past 12 months and counts two of the top five U.S. P&C insurers and the two leading insurers in the Australian market among its clients. Near-term plans include expanding the technical team, deepening partnerships with imagery providers, and broadening geographic coverage into Europe and Southeast Asia. The company intends to roll out offerings to the commercial property sector and other built-environment customers such as banks, asset managers and other financial institutions. Arturo provides structured property characteristic data and predictive analysis for residential and commercial properties using satellite, aerial, drone, and ground-level imagery. The company leverages deep-learning models to deliver differentiated property data—often in as little as five seconds—for use across pricing, underwriting, renewal and claims workflows. Arturo was spun out of American Family Insurance in 2018 after more than three years as an internal R&D group. Since launching as a standalone company it has steadily gained clients and industry recognition for its models. The company serves Property & Casualty insurance, reinsurance, lending, and securities markets. Arturo plans to use its recent financing to expand its business in North America and the Asia Pacific. Arturo develops deep-learning property analytics that extract structured property observations and predictions from satellite, aerial, drone, and ground-level imagery. Its models generate detailed property information often in under five seconds and are positioned for use across P&C insurance, reinsurance, lending, securities, and property management. The technology originated from more than three years of research and investment inside American Family Insurance, with product feedback from claims and underwriting professionals. Arturo was created adjacent to real customer problems through American Family’s Data Science and Analytics Lab and was spun out to bring the technology to a broader market. American Family remains both a customer and an investor following the spin-out. Arturo leverages proprietary data sources alongside imagery to deliver on-demand, near-real-time property data.
